CREATING AN EXPERIENCE at retail: We’ve heard the phrase countless times. One could argue that stores are already innate experiences. Yet, the definition of “experience” has evolved and now reflects a continued increase in the utilization of showrooms, experience-only brand activations (with or without purchasable goods) and roving pop-ups. Permanent stores, too, possess a reinvigorated emphasis on the in-store experience, especially since the pandemic.
The category with the highest number of submissions in our 31st annual International Visual Competition (pg. 22) was “Temporary/Pop-Up Retail Space,” as it has been for roughly the last five years.
Temporary activations and pop-ups have been favored strategies for creating unique brand experiences for some time, but in recent years, they’ve exploded in popularity and have shifted to become another channel to reach consumers. Whether complex or simplistic in strategy or design, temporary retail can be used as another vehicle to garner brand recognition or promote reinvention. Most importantly, it can be used to create lasting memories for shoppers.
Our 2024 “Best in Show” winner for the Visual Competition did just that. A brand activation showcasing Michael Kors’ (New York) latest Empire Jacquard print, the temporary display was styled like a deconstructed airplane in Paris’ Galeries Lafayette. Though this VM spectacle was primarily to raise awareness for the brand and its latest offerings, it also attracted new customers – not to mention our 2024 judges – with its clever and eye-catching references to air travel.
